1. Install "onionscan.x86_64" package
Here is a brief guide to show you how to install onionscan.x86_64 on Fedora 39
$
sudo dnf update
Copied
$
sudo dnf install
onionscan.x86_64
Copied
2. Uninstall "onionscan.x86_64" package
Please follow the guidelines below to uninstall onionscan.x86_64 on Fedora 39:
$
sudo dnf remove
onionscan.x86_64
Copied
$
sudo dnf autoremove
Copied
3. Information about the onionscan.x86_64 package on Fedora 39
Last metadata expiration check: 1:58:34 ago on Thu Mar 7 11:44:58 2024.
Available Packages
Name : onionscan
Version : 0.2
Release : 13.fc37
Architecture : x86_64
Size : 3.2 M
Source : onionscan-0.2-13.fc37.src.rpm
Repository : fedora
Summary : Tool for investigating the Dark Web
URL : https://github.com/s-rah/onionscan
License : MIT
Description :
: OnionScan is a free and open source tool for investigating the Dark Web.
